2011-09-12 12 views
20

The documentation for fileobject.encoding कहा गया है कि यह None हो सकता है और उस स्थिति में, "सिस्टम डिफ़ॉल्ट एन्कोडिंग" प्रयोग किया जाता है।आप कैसे पता लगाते हैं कि "सिस्टम डिफ़ॉल्ट एन्कोडिंग" क्या है?

मैं कैसे पता लगा सकते हैं कि इस एन्कोडिंग है?

उत्तर

49

sys.getdefaultencoding()

(बहुत ज्यादा शिकायत नहीं है, लेकिन यह शायद कुछ आप googled है चाहिए -। यह python os default encoding के लिए पहला परिणाम है, और python system default encoding के लिए सेकंड)

+1

मैं इसे गूगल का प्रयास किया, लेकिन किसी कारण से मैंने जवाब को नजरअंदाज कर दिया। वैसे भी जवाब देने के लिए धन्यवाद! –

+0

कोई समस्या नहीं है। :) – Amber

+18

एफवाईआई, "सिस्टम डिफ़ॉल्ट टेक्स्ट एन्कोडिंग निर्धारित करने" के लिए # 1 Google परिणाम अब यह उत्तर है। – Pops